Overview
Japan FSA outsourcing expectations sit across sector-specific supervisory guidelines.
It applies to regulated organizations and other institutions within scope of the framework and requires organizations to identify, assess, govern, monitor, and manage risks introduced by third parties, outsourcers, and service providers throughout the entire relationship lifecycle.
Rather than prescribing identical controls for every relationship, the regulation emphasizes a risk-based approach, requiring organizations to apply governance, oversight, controls, monitoring, and due diligence according to the criticality and risk of each relationship.
